Introduction to Wi-Fi 5 and Wi-Fi 6
Wi-Fi 5, based on the 802.11ac standard, was introduced in 2014 and marked a significant leap in wireless networking speed and efficiency. Operating mainly on the 5 GHz frequency band, Wi-Fi 5 can deliver speeds up to 3.5 Gbps.
Wi-Fi 6, known technically as 802.11ax, was introduced in 2019 as the next generation of Wi-Fi. Designed to improve network speed, efficiency, and capacity—especially in high-density environments—Wi-Fi 6 supports both 2.4 GHz and 5 GHz bands and can reach speeds up to 9.6 Gbps.
Key Differences Between Wi-Fi 5 and Wi-Fi 6
1. Data Transfer Speed
Wi-Fi 6 significantly boosts data transfer rates compared to Wi-Fi 5, enabling faster downloads and uploads, seamless 4K/8K video streaming, and an improved online gaming experience. These speed gains are due to technical advancements like 1024-QAM modulation and the use of 160 MHz channels.
2. Performance in Crowded Environments
One of Wi-Fi 6's standout benefits is its superior performance in environments with many connected devices. Technologies such as OFDMA (Orthogonal Frequency Division Multiple Access) and MU-MIMO (Multi-User, Multiple-Input, Multiple-Output) allow Wi-Fi 6 routers to communicate with multiple devices simultaneously, reducing delay and congestion. This is especially valuable in busy offices, schools, and public spaces.
3. Energy Efficiency and Battery Life
Wi-Fi 6 introduces Target Wake Time (TWT), allowing devices to schedule their wake times. This reduces power consumption and extends battery life—an important advantage for low-power devices and the Internet of Things (IoT).
4. Network Security
Wi-Fi 6 supports the WPA3 security protocol, offering stronger protection against cyberattacks and unauthorized access. This improved security is crucial for users concerned about safeguarding sensitive data.

Practical Applications and Real-World Use Cases
With its advanced features, Wi-Fi 6 is well-suited for a variety of scenarios:
- Smart Homes: As the number of connected devices grows in modern households, Wi-Fi 6 ensures stable and high-speed connectivity for all smart gadgets.
- High-Density Workplaces: Offices with many employees benefit from better bandwidth management and improved network performance with Wi-Fi 6.
- Educational Institutions and Public Venues: Places like universities and airports, where large numbers of users connect to the network, see a significant improvement in user experience with Wi-Fi 6.

Advantages, Challenges, and Future Outlook
Advantages
- Higher Speeds: Enhanced data transfer rates for demanding applications.
- Better Performance in Crowded Environments: Improved handling of multiple device connections.
- Lower Power Consumption: Extended battery life for devices.
- Enhanced Security: Stronger data protection with WPA3.
Challenges
- Upgrade Costs: Upgrading may require purchasing new routers and compatible devices.
- Backward Compatibility: Some older devices may not support Wi-Fi 6 features.

Future Perspective
As the use of connected devices and the demand for faster wireless networks continue to rise, Wi-Fi 6 is expected to become the dominant standard for wireless connectivity. The development of related technologies, such as Wi-Fi 6E with 6 GHz band support, will further expand network performance and capabilities in the near future.
Is Upgrading to Wi-Fi 6 Worth It?
The decision to upgrade to Wi-Fi 6 depends on individual needs and specific circumstances. If you live or work in an environment with many connected devices or require faster speeds and enhanced security, upgrading to Wi-Fi 6 can deliver significant benefits. However, for users with simpler networks and fewer devices, Wi-Fi 5 may still suffice.
Ultimately, as wireless technology continues to advance and user demands increase, investing in Wi-Fi 6 can be a smart move to ensure future-ready connectivity.
